Skip to content

pac code add-data-source not working #137

@JackBaxter722

Description

@JackBaxter722

Describe the bug

When trying to add pac code add-data-source -a "shared_office365users" -c "<my_connection_id>" or pac code add-data-source -a "shared_sharepointonline" -c "<my_connection_id>" -t "<my_table_id>" -d "<double_encoded_sharepoint_site_url>", I get the following error:

Error: Request failed: {}
at e.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:14093)
at e.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:7723)
at Generator.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:10279)
at Generator.throw (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11195)
at g (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11338)
at u (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11577)
at process.processTicksAndRejections (node:internal/process/task_queues:105:5)

The issue occurs in a First Release and Dev environment with Code Apps enabled. The 'Preview' badge is visible in each environment's admin center.

Image

I am able to add a dataverse table pac code add-data-source -a dataverse -t contact and interact with the data in the app.

Steps to Reproduce

Build samples\FluentSample
run pac add-data-source for sharepoint and office 365 users

Expected behavior

Allow user to interact with connectors (office 365 users, sharepoint, dataverse, etc.)

Actual behavior

Error: Request failed: {}
at e.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:14093)
at e.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:7723)
at Generator. (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:10279)
at Generator.throw (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11195)
at g (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11338)
at u (C:\Users\XXXXXX\AppData\Local\Microsoft\PowerAppsCli\Microsoft.PowerApps.CLI.1.49.4\tools\powerapps-cli.js:2:11577)
at process.processTicksAndRejections (node:internal/process/task_queues:105:5)

Screenshots or Error Messages

Environment information

  • First Release w/ Code Apps (preview) enabled
  • Dev environment w/ Code Apps (preview) enabled

Additional context

package.json:

{
"name": "fluentsample",
"private": true,
"version": "0.0.0",
"type": "module",
"scripts": {
"dev": "start vite && start pac code run",
"build": "tsc -b && vite build",
"lint": "eslint .",
"preview": "vite preview"
},
"dependencies": {
"@fluentui/react-components": "^9.67.0",
"@fluentui/react-icons": "^2.0.306",
"@microsoft/power-apps": "^0.3.21",
"@tanstack/react-query": "^5.56.0",
"react": "^18.2.0",
"react-dom": "^18.2.0",
"react-router-dom": "^6.26.0",
"typescript": "^5.8.3"
},
"devDependencies": {
"@eslint/js": "^9.30.1",
"@pa-client/power-code-sdk": "https://github.com/microsoft/PowerAppsCodeApps/releases/download/v0.0.4/7-31-pa-client-power-code-sdk-0.0.1.tgz",
"@types/react": "^18.2.0",
"@types/react-dom": "^18.2.0",
"@vitejs/plugin-react": "^4.6.0",
"eslint": "^9.30.1",
"eslint-plugin-react-hooks": "^5.2.0",
"eslint-plugin-react-refresh": "^0.4.20",
"globals": "^16.3.0",
"typescript": "~5.8.3",
"typescript-eslint": "^8.35.1",
"vite": "^7.0.4"
}
}

Any help would be great, thanks!

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't working

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ions